Sodium tert-Butoxide is positioned in industrial supply as a highly reactive alkoxide base, commonly used in organic synthesis, condensation reactions, and deprotonation processes. It is valued for its strong basicity and relatively low nucleophilicity, making it suitable for elimination reactions and selective transformations in fine chemical and pharmaceutical intermediate production.
In commercial supply, it is typically provided either as a moisture-sensitive solid powder or as a solution in compatible solvents such as tert-butanol. Due to its high reactivity toward moisture and air, it is handled under controlled conditions and used as a processing reagent rather than a direct formulation ingredient.
